Over the past 29 years, there have been 15 property sales recorded in the S72 8JH postcode area. The highest sale price reached £251,000, while the most recent sale was for a semi-detached house sold in May 2024 for £251,000.
The estimated average property value in S72 8JH currently stands at £199,779, which is roughly in line with the city average (within ±8%), suggesting property prices reflect broader market trends.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£2,474.
Property prices in S72 8JH have risen by 6.9% over the past year , with a total increase of 37.4% over the past five years, and a long-term rise of 70.1% over the past decade.
The most common type of property sold in the area is semi-detached, making up around 73% of transactions , followed by detached.
Housing in S72 8JH is predominantly owner-occupied, with an estimated 100% of homes being lived in by the owners.
